I just went to a waterpark yesterday, kiddie pools and everything. I actually purchased a lanyard with a waterproof casing as an added layer of protection for the Z70 Ultra, knowing full well the phone's IP68 and IP69 rating.

While in the midst of entertaining my kids splashing about, a stranger pointed out to me that my 'waterproof casing' was half-filled with water. I quickly checked on my phone, and my Z70 Ultra was a black empty screen, it was doing a short and quick vibration, followed by a white flash, and it repeated over and over as though it was in an endless loop. I took it out of the casing, and immediately felt the heat of the phone's surface was unlike anything that I've ever experienced with the phone, even during the times when I put it through severe gaming sessions while multi-tasking with YouTube playing in the background and many apps running.

It took a very, very long time to exit its loop and cool down, and I figured the battery finally depleted. However when I tried to charge it, my Anker powerbank showed output was fluctuating between 0.1-0.2W, when a normal charge would be 64-65W. At that point I realised I had a very serious problem. Till now my phone is unable to charge and unable to be powered on.

Can someone advise me what's going on, and what steps I can take to rectify this? The phone is barely 11 months old and I've taken very good care of it. I take it to the toilet during showers and it survives splashes and the occasional rinse no problem. The water park water was typical pool water, and it was at the kids' playground area, meaning the water was about knee-deep. At most it went through the kids water slides with me, but then again, its also 'protected' by the waterproof casing. Some one please advise me what to do next please!
